To minimize the risk of your videos being placed under review, ensure compliance with TikTok's community guidelines, avoid violations such as copyright infringement or inappropriate content, and refrain from spamming hashtags like #viralvedio excessively. Consistently creating authentic content can improve your account's standing and reduce interruptions. Additionally, if your account is frozen or restricted, reporting the issue through TikTok’s official support channels while rallying community support using relevant hashtags can accelerate the resolution process. Staying informed about platform updates and participating in creator forums enhances awareness and preparedness against such challenges.
